This Program Executive Railway System Engineering is a specialized, advanced degree designed to create high-level managers and experts in the global rail and urban transportation sectors. The primary goal is to address the need for systems-thinking leadership capable of handling the entire lifecycle of modern railway systems, from initial planning and design to maintenance and technological integration. This executive-level training is critical for professional advancement in a rapidly evolving industry.
The curriculum is structured around an intensive “Executive Sandwich Format,” often spanning approximately 15 months. This design allows busy working professionals to continue their careers while studying, with classes typically scheduled in concentrated weekly modules throughout the year. The academic framework ensures comprehensive coverage of vital subjects, including rail system planning, logistics, and urban mobility strategies.
A key strength of the program is its emphasis on applied knowledge. Students are required to undertake a significant professional assignment or internship, usually lasting several months, where they apply complex systems engineering principles to real-world projects. This practical experience is complemented by a mini-dissertation and site visits, ensuring a blend of theoretical depth and tangible problem-solving skills.
Ultimately, this program is intended to elevate participants’ expertise beyond typical engineering qualifications. By focusing on systems integration, strategic management, and innovation, it prepares graduates to lead multidisciplinary project teams and guide organizations through technological and operational challenges, positioning them for top-tier executive and leadership roles in the railway industry.
